Hi! My name is Bobby from Korea and I am a wonderful approximately 6 year old male Labrador Retriever. I am approximately 60 lbs. and so excited to find my new forever home. I am very happy, affectionate, and friendly. l was saved from the Korean dog meat farm where I was due to be slaughtered. I don't know how I ended up there but I was so scared and I used to hear the cries from the other dogs as they were taken away. The activists came and saved us and I can't wait to come to America and find a family to love and care for me forever. Approximately over a million dogs a year are slaughtered to be eaten. I am so lucky to get a one-way ticket to Seattle to find my new family. Take me on car rides, walks in the park, and I will become your best friend. I get along well with people of all ages, gentle kids, and other dogs. I will do best with a loving family that can give me lots of love, and affection! My adoption fee of $895 will cover my spay/neuter, DA2PP shots, Rabies, Bordetella, Deworm, Heart Worm Test, Microchip, Boarding Fees, Health Certificate and airline transport cost from Korea to Seattle. A GPS tracker or Apple AirTag is required for all adopted dogs. You can bring your own when adopting or you can purchase an AirTag from us. We cannot guarantee breed or age. The adoption fee is firm and helps save the life of another dog needing rescue and our other dogs in need of medical care.
